3 reasons why Karun Nair can come back to Indian team for England tour

India’s much-anticipated tour to England commences on June 20th next month. The Indian team will start their World Test Championship Cycle 2025-2027 with the five-match test series against England in England. With both Rohit Sharma and Virat Kohli now retired from the game’s toughest format, the tour is set to test India’s young batting order. It will also provide an opportunity to the new as well as the returning batters to make a mark for themselves in the team. Amongst the former pros who can make a return to the national side is Delhi’s middle Karun Nair. The right-handed batter has been included in India A’s side that will visit England to play against the English Lions in preparation for the test season ahead.

Here is the list of three reasons why Karun Nair can see himself returning to baggy whites ahead of the English tour.

3) Great Ranji Form 

Karun Nair had shown great form in the 2024-25 Ranji Trophy. The experienced right-handed batter had scored 863 runs in the last Ranji season at an average of 49.95. He also scored 4 tons in the domestic event. To add to this, the middle-order batter had also amassed 779 runs in the Vijay Hazare Trophy with five centuries. His sublime form can be greatly put to use against quality English bowlers in tough conditions.

2) His experience of playing at the highest level

Karun Nair had made his debut for the Indian test side back in the year 2016 against England in the home series. Karun Nair has the experience of playing 6 test matches for India. He has scored 374 runs at an average of 62.4. He played as a middle-order batter and his experience of already representing the nation may come in handy in a relatively younger batting line-up.

1) Good form in IPL

Karun Nair has shown that his form isn’t a season wonder as he has successfully replicated it in the game’s shortest format. He has scored 154 runs in 6 IPL innings so far at a strike rate of 188. His highest knock, 88, came in a match-winning cause. His IPL stats prove that he is a dynamic batter who can play any role given the situation of the innings.
